Background: Nucleophosmin (NPM, also known as B23, numatrin or NO38) is an abundant phosphoprotein primarily found in nucleoli. It has been implicated in several distinct cellμlar functions, including assembly and transport of ribosomes, cytoplasmic/nuclear trafficking, regμlation of DNA polymerase α activity, centrosome duplication and molecμlar chaperoning activities. The NPM gene is also known for its fusion with the anaplastic lymphoma kinase (ALK) receptor tyrosine kinase. The NPM portion contributes to transformation by providing a dimerization domain, which resμlts in activation of the fused kinase.
